我在dataGridView表中插入新行。我有一个sql sting,看起来像这样。
sql = @"INSERT INTO " + myNameRange + " VALUES ("+rowString+")";
我的方法看起来像这样。
public static void inSertRow(string myNameRange, string rowString)
{
string sql = null;
sql = @"INSERT INTO " + myNameRange + " VALUES ("+rowString+")";
if (myCommand == null)
{
MessageBox.Show("ERROR :: dfsdfsdf");
}
myCommand.CommandText = sql;
myCommand.ExecuteNonQuery();
}
当我将“rowString”引入sql字符串的VALUES部分时,我的问题是;
有没有办法在该单元格中设置信息的“对齐”/对齐?可以在sql字符串中完成吗?
所以,如果我输入的信息的rowString是('city','state','zip'),我希望城市和州在单元格中保持对齐,但是拉链要居中对齐..这可以是做什么?
谢谢
答案 0 :(得分:0)
格式化数据的方式不是数据库的工作。插入数据时,您希望尽可能简单。格式化数据的时间是从数据库中读取数据的时间。
您可能希望在一个应用程序中集中证明您的数据,而不是在另一个应用程序中。但是,存储在数据库中的值保持不变。
如果要删除前导或尾随空格,请使用ltrim
和rtrim
函数。